ODOT announces upcoming closure of US 62 in Fayette County

The Ohio Department of Transportation (ODOT) will close US 62 west between state Route 41 and the ODOT distributor road east of US 35 on Jan. 28 for a little over a year for storm sewer replacement and repaving.

The posted detour is US 62 west to US 22 west to the ODOT distributor road to US 62 west or reverse. Local access will be maintained.

Court Street will be reduced to one lane in each direction between South Hinde Street and Highland Ave for 10 days beginning Jan. 28.

Also starting Jan. 28, the Tri-County Triangle Trail bike path in this zone will be closed for 10 days.

The intersection of Highland Avenue, US 22 and US 62 will be restricted for four days, but traffic will be maintained.
